  6. Harenadraco prima: The first #troodontid from the Upper #Cretaceous Baruungoyot Formation of #Mongolia
    novataxa.blogspot.com/2024/07/

    "Among non-avian #dinosaurs, #troodontids are relatively rare but diverse. The #Nemegt Basin in the Mongolian #Gobi Desert, which incorporates three of the most fossiliferous beds in the world, is one such region with high #troodontid diversity and has also produced eight troodontid taxa until now."
